Alpine: One-year Mercedes gearbox deal gives ‘headroom’ for 2026

© XPB  Phillip van Osten 10/01/2025 at 13:5110/01/2025 at 14:39 Alpine has explained that its decision to adopt Mercedes' gearbox for the first year of Formula 1's new regulations in 2026 reflects a calculated move to balance resources and maintain competitiveness during a pivotal era. While the Renault-owned team will rely on the German manufacturer's transmission hardware for a single season, team principal Oliver Oakes has confirmed that Alpine intends to return to using its own gearbox from 2027 onward.
